Output af8ce21b6c7499b5afc8450ec83be77f165bf74f34639d0a1eac333e688ecd88:1

value
6766000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a010b8181786fdc66a80022d05d058eba672d7fa OP_EQUAL
address
3GHN4uE9pn4kQgERBiWTLezgkPWDdEEbcH
transaction
af8ce21b6c7499b5afc8450ec83be77f165bf74f34639d0a1eac333e688ecd88
confirmations
394981
spent
true